			<![CDATA[I'm actually prepping to go see a local band that this board would love to death; it's a Kalamazoo band called Blue Dahlia <br /><a href="http://www.myspace.com/bluedahliamusic" >BLUE DAHLIA MYSPACE</a><br /><br />Best I can describe them is a cross between the Cocteau Twins, Dead Can Dance and the soundtrack to a silent film, which is what they do with stunning excellence. They have built a decent sized following by composing original soundtracks to old public domain silent films of the 20's. Their favorite subject is Buster Keaton, which they do amazing soundtracks to his classic films "The General" and "The Naviagator". We just saw Blue Dahlia do another Keaton classic "Seven Chances"; it's great, spirited theatrical music, plus all the bells, penny whistles and sound FX used for silent films, all blended with sweet, haunting vocals, echo drenched guitars and inventive polycultural drumming. This Wednesday, we go to see them perform their soundtrack with a showing of the old Clara bow Film "IT". All proceeds go to support NPR in Kalamazoo.<br /><br />Seriously folks, if you've been digging Burial's "Untrue", you will flip for Blue Dahlia's latest album, "This Floating World". It has some of the same haunting feel as Burial, but achieved with purely organic instrumentation; very unique and cool. They have a clip of the title track on their MySpace site, and it is nothing short of amazing (It's 11 minutes long, but worth every second!). 			<![CDATA[@ Ben, you've got to check out Dorando, the Bay Area counterpart to Al Green.  Also, Al Green's Belle Album is mostly hitless, but it's such a monstrously great record, written after the death of his girlfriend and leading into him becoming a reverend.  Like Marvin Gaye's Here, My Dear in how heartbreaking it is (Marvin gets a divorce from his wife aka Berry Gordy's sister and is forced to give her the proceeds of his next album, so he writes the whole thing about their relationship all the way through the acrimonious divorce.  It's pulled off the shelves not to long after release and goes out of print for decades.  No hits, but gorgeous.<br /><br />@ Kernowdrunk, thanks for the rec. for Kemialliset Ystavat.
